Our Story
In 2019, co-founders Jennifer Cortez and Revida Rahman joined forces to address the pressing issues faced by students of color in Williamson County. Initiated by a group of concerned Black parents, One Willco emerged from the Cultural Competency Council meetings, aiming to combat racial slurs, harmful assignments, and disproportionate discipline affecting Black students. This organization is dedicated to ensuring safety and equal opportunities for all children in the community.
Our Impact
One Willco advocates for equitable policies at the school board and district levels, striving to eliminate disparities in student outcomes across racial and ethnic lines. The organization works tirelessly to honor the unique identities of students of color, fostering an environment where they can thrive free from racism.
